Psychological Factors
Our mindset and surroundings play a crucial role in determining our attention span. Motivation is key, but stress and emotional ups and downs can hinder our ability to focus. High stress levels can make it harder for our brains to filter distractions, leading to a shorter attention span. Moreover, our emotional state can also affect our ability to concentrate.
- Manage Stress: Find healthy ways to manage stress, such as meditation, yoga, or deep breathing exercises.
- Regulate Emotional State: Acknowledge and manage your emotions to maintain a calm and focused mindset.
Environmental Factors
The environment we create can significantly impact our attention span. Lighting, colors, and background noise can all affect cognitive performance. For example, studies have shown that cool lighting and blue tones can improve focus and concentration, while loud or distracting noises can hinder attention span.

- Optimize Lighting: Use cool lighting and consider using blue-light blocking glasses or apps.
- Manage Noise: Minimize background noise by using noise-cancelling headphones or finding a quiet workspace.
Physical Factors
Our physical well-being also plays a significant role in maintaining a healthy attention span. Exercise has a direct link to cognitive ability, especially attention span. Regular physical activity can increase the availability of brain chemicals that promote new brain connections, reduce stress, and improve sleep.
- Exercise Regularly: Engage in regular physical activity to promote brain health and improve attention span.
- Get Enough Sleep: Prioritize sleep to ensure our brains are well-rested and ready to focus.
Lifestyle Factors
Our lifestyle choices can also impact our attention span. The foods we eat can play a significant role in maintaining brain health and cognitive function. Incorporating foods rich in antioxidants and other nutrients can help improve attention span and boost overall well-being.

- Eat a Balanced Diet: Incorporate foods rich in antioxidants, such as berries, leafy greens, and nuts.
-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water throughout the day to maintain focus and productivity.
